Where does “ard-spyrrydagh” come from?

ard-spyrrydagh (Manx) comes from Manx spyrryd, from Old Irish spirut, from Latin spīritus, from Latin spīrō, from Proto-Indo-European (s)peys- — to blow, breathe; to blow to make noise; to blow;...

ard-spyrrydagh (Manx): high-spirited
